25 ml of 1M HCI la0) at 23.4°C was added to 25 ml of 1M NAOH at 23.4'C. The final temperature of the reaction mixture was 29.7 C. Calculate A H (KJ/mol). Density of each solution is 1.04 g/ml and Specific heat of water =4.184 J/g."C
